A French Carved Wood Framed Mirror

19th century
Description

A 19thC French rectangular wall mirror. The frame appears to be of pitch pine which has been finely carved with bead and linked stlylised scroll decoration. The inner part of the frame was gold painted which has been rubbed back. the whole appearance is very pleasing and therfe are no decorative pieces missing. The glass is original as is the wooden back.

72 cm wide by 101cm tall and approximately 3 cm deep.
